"""
The generators in this directory produce keystone compliant tokens for use in
testing.
They should be considered part of the public API because they may be relied
upon to generate test tokens for other clients. However they should never be
imported into the main client (keystoneclient or other). Because of this there
may be dependencies from this module on libraries that are only available in
testing.
"""
from keystoneclient.fixture.exception import FixtureValidationError # noqa
from keystoneclient.fixture.v2 import Token as V2Token # noqa
from keystoneclient.fixture.v3 import Token as V3Token # noqa
__all__ = ['V2Token', 'V3Token', 'FixtureValidationError']
